Hybrid architecture, which implies a combination of high-performance (Performance-cores) and energy-efficient (Efficient-core) cores. Support for DDR5 standard and PCI Express 5.0 interface.
Performance-cores are high-performance cores capable of simultaneously executing up to two computation threads. Efficient-core — energy-efficient cores do not support Hyper-Threading and are designed to handle background workloads.

Model overview based on user reviews  
The Intel Core i5 Alder Lake series offers a range of processors that are well-regarded for their powerful performance and good price-to-quality ratio. Users appreciate the 10 cores and 16 threads in models like the i5-12600KF, which handle multitasking and gaming efficiently. The processors support DDR5 memory and show excellent benchmark results. However, they require effective cooling due to their tendency to heat up during intensive tasks. Some models lack integrated graphics, which might be a downside for users without a dedicated GPU. Despite these minor drawbacks, the series is praised for its overclocking capabilities and suitability for mid-range gaming systems and workstations. Overall, the Intel Core i5 Alder Lake processors are a solid choice for those seeking a balance of performance and affordability.
